From what I saw on the Foster Coach Sales Facebook page earlier today, they’ve got some really impressive vehicles listed. One of them is this brand-new custom Horton conversion mounted on a Ford F550 gas chassis. It looks incredibly well put together—definitely the kind of rig you’d want if you’re in the market for something reliable and high-quality. I scrolled through their album, and there were a few photos that caught my attention. The first one shows a Horton Type I ambulance sitting proudly on the Ford F550 chassis. It’s sleek, professional-looking, and seems like it would be a game-changer for any emergency response team. The Foster Coach Sales page mentions that these images are from their own photo shoot, so they’ve clearly taken pride in capturing every detail. Another shot highlights the interior, which is just as impressive as the exterior. They’ve equipped it with a Stryker power load system, which is a big deal for anyone familiar with medical transport. This system makes loading and unloading patients much easier, cutting down on strain for the crew while improving safety. It’s a feature that really sets this vehicle apart from others in its class. Pickup Truck Roll Bar

pickup truck Roll Bar
 
Also commonly known as a roll cage, it is a metal frame structure installed above the pickup truck compartment. It is mainly made of high-strength steel pipes or aluminum alloy pipes and is designed to provide additional safety protection for pickup trucks, especially in the event of a rollover or rollover accident, to effectively prevent the compartment from deforming and protect the safety of passengers. At the same time, it also has a certain degree of decorativeness and practicality, which can enhance the off-road style of the pickup truck and facilitate the installation of auxiliary lighting equipment, luggage racks and other accessories.
 
  • Enhanced security:
When the vehicle rolls over, the Roll Bar can bear most of the impact force of the vehicle body, maintain the shape of the vehicle compartment, and prevent the occupants from being seriously squeezed and injured, greatly improving the survival rate of the driver and passengers in the accident.
 
  • Provide installation points:
The top crossbar is usually pre-drilled with multiple mounting holes, which makes it convenient for the owner to install various lamps, such as off-road spotlights, work lights, etc., to provide better lighting effects when driving at night or working in the field. In addition, luggage racks, cargo racks, etc. can also be installed to increase the cargo capacity and practicality of the pickup truck.
 
  • Protect the rear window:
When loading and unloading goods, it can prevent the goods from accidentally hitting the rear window, reduce the risk of window glass being broken, and protect the integrity of the vehicle.
 
  • Customized service:
For vehicles with special requirements or personalized modifications, some manufacturers also provide customized Roll Bar production services. The height, shape, installation position and other parameters of the roll bar can be adjusted according to the owner's requirements to meet different usage scenarios and aesthetic needs.
